Subject: [PATCH] sock: fix potential memory leak in proto_register()
Date: Mon, 19 Aug 2019 09:35:56 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1566178556-46071-1-git-send-email-zhang.lin16@zte.com.cn> (raw)

If protocols registered exceeded PROTO_INUSE_NR, prot will be
added to proto_list, but no available bit left for prot in
proto_inuse_idx.

Signed-off-by: zhanglin <zhang.lin16@zte.com.cn>
---
 net/core/sock.c | 21 ++++++++++++++-------
 1 file changed, 14 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)

diff --git a/net/core/sock.c b/net/core/sock.c
index bc3512f230a3..25388d429f6a 100644
--- a/net/core/sock.c
+++ b/net/core/sock.c
@@ -3139,16 +3139,17 @@ static __init int net_inuse_init(void)
 
 core_initcall(net_inuse_init);
 
-static void assign_proto_idx(struct proto *prot)
+static int assign_proto_idx(struct proto *prot)
 {
 	prot->inuse_idx = find_first_zero_bit(proto_inuse_idx, PROTO_INUSE_NR);
 
 	if (unlikely(prot->inuse_idx == PROTO_INUSE_NR - 1)) {
 		pr_err("PROTO_INUSE_NR exhausted\n");
-		return;
+		return -ENOSPC;
 	}
 
 	set_bit(prot->inuse_idx, proto_inuse_idx);
+	return 0;
 }
 
 static void release_proto_idx(struct proto *prot)
@@ -3243,18 +3244,24 @@ int proto_register(struct proto *prot, int alloc_slab)
 	}
 
 	mutex_lock(&proto_list_mutex);
+	if (assign_proto_idx(prot)) {
+		mutex_unlock(&proto_list_mutex);
+		goto out_free_timewait_sock_slab_name;
+	}
 	list_add(&prot->node, &proto_list);
-	assign_proto_idx(prot);
 	mutex_unlock(&proto_list_mutex);
 	return 0;
 
 out_free_timewait_sock_slab_name:
-	kfree(prot->twsk_prot->twsk_slab_name);
+	if (alloc_slab && prot->twsk_prot)
+		kfree(prot->twsk_prot->twsk_slab_name);
 out_free_request_sock_slab:
-	req_prot_cleanup(prot->rsk_prot);
+	if (alloc_slab) {
+		req_prot_cleanup(prot->rsk_prot);
 
-	kmem_cache_destroy(prot->slab);
-	prot->slab = NULL;
+		kmem_cache_destroy(prot->slab);
+		prot->slab = NULL;
+	}
 out:
 	return -ENOBUFS;
 }
